Boost Your E-Bike Speed: Essential Tips for a Quicker Ride

Increasing your e-bike velocity requires a combination of proper maintenance, riding techniques, and component optimization. This guide explores five actionable strategies to help you achieve higher speeds while maintaining safety and efficiency.

Optimize Battery Performance

Your e-bike's battery is the primary factor influencing motor output and overall speed. Proper care ensures consistent power delivery, especially during high-demand scenarios like uphill climbs or acceleration.

Charge Management

Avoid frequent partial charges, as lithium-ion batteries perform best when cycled between 20% and 80% capacity. For maximum electric bike velocity, store batteries at room temperature and use manufacturer-approved chargers. Research from energy.gov confirms that proper charging habits can extend battery lifespan by up to 30%.

Reduce Weight and Drag

Every extra kilogram impacts your e-bike's acceleration and top speed. Streamlining your setup can significantly improve e-bike performance without requiring motor modifications.

Remove unnecessary accessories and consider lightweight alternatives for racks or bags. Aerodynamic positioning—such as lowering your torso—can reduce wind resistance by 15-20%, according to cycling efficiency studies.

Adjust Pedal Assist Levels

Strategic use of pedal assist (PAS) settings allows you to balance speed with battery conservation. Higher assist levels provide immediate boost but drain power faster.

For sustained e-bike acceleration, use moderate assist (Level 2-3) while maintaining a steady cadence of 70-90 RPM. This approach optimizes motor efficiency and extends your riding range.

Maintain Tire Pressure

Proper inflation directly affects rolling resistance—a critical factor in achieving maximum electric bicycle speed. Underinflated tires can reduce efficiency by up to 30%.

Check pressure weekly using a digital gauge, adhering to the PSI range printed on your tire sidewall. For road cycling, aim for the higher end of the recommended range to minimize friction.

Upgrade Key Components

While factory settings determine your e-bike's legal speed limit, certain upgrades can enhance responsiveness and overall ride quality within permitted ranges.

Consider installing slick tires for pavement riding or a more efficient chain lubrication system. Some riders report 5-10% speed improvement after switching to lighter wheelsets. Always consult local regulations before modifying motor controllers or other restricted components.
